Overview

Hiring a BCBA to join our growing team in North Conway, NH and surrounding areas! Relocation assistance available. Responsibilities

Conduct functional behavior assessments to identify target behaviors and develop appropriate treatment plans. Collaborate with families, caregivers, and other professionals to gather information, set goals, and develop behavior intervention plans. Implement behavior analytic strategies and interventions to address behavioral challenges and improve functional skills. Provide direct behavior analysis therapy to individuals, both in clinical settings and in natural environments. Collect and analyze data to evaluate treatment effectiveness and make necessary adjustments to behavior plans. Train and supervise behavior technicians and other team members in implementing behavior intervention strategies. Maintain accurate and detailed records of client progress, behavior plans, and treatment outcomes. Stay current with the latest research and developments in the field of behavior analysis and autism treatment. Qualifications

Masters degree in Applied Behavior Analysis, Psychology, or a related field. Current BCBA certification from the Behavior Analyst Certification Board (BACB). Experience working with individuals with autism spectrum disorders and other developmental disabilities. Strong knowledge of behavior analysis principles and techniques, including functional behavior assessment and behavior intervention plan development.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, with the ability to collaborate effectively with clients, families, and team members. Ability to work independently, demonstrate problem-solving skills, and make clinical decisions based on data analysis. Proficient in using data collection software and technology for behavior analysis. Benefits
